This workshop aims to:
Provide a basic understanding of rheology as related to powder suspensions Keep the industry informed of the latest innovations in rheological measurement techniques
The workshop is primarily of interest to technicians and engineers working in the areas of product formulation, quality and process control within the ceramic sectors. Participation in these workshops will increase rheological understanding and also provide a significant insight into how rheology can be used to enhance product performance in manufacture and end use. No previous knowledge of rheology is required, since the various topics will be treated at a basic level. Furthermore, the selected case studies will be realistic industrial situations presented by technical people. The workshop will include lectures, case studies and laboratory demonstrations on common rheological instrumentation and will take place over 2 full days, commencing at 9.00 am and concluding at 5.00 pm. The Italian Society of Rheology (SIR) organizes every two years the Italian Rheology Conference, which is the meeting point of the National and International rheological community to promote knowledge and discuss research in the field of rheology. The Conference consists of keynote lectures, oral communications and posters on topics related to all the thematic areas of rheology.
The XIX edition will be held in the conference rooms of Plesso Belmeloro, in the city centre of Bologna, in June 16th-19th, 2026.
